At The Top
-- THOMAS JOHNSON Johnson, an environmental engineer, was promoted to vice president of the Northwest Region offices for Tetra Tech Inc., an environmental-science and engineering company.
-- LYLE NAISH Naish was promoted from manager of federal contracts to vice president of federal programs for Blue Cross of Washington and Alaska.
-- CHARLES JACKSON Jackson will be responsible for developing customized training classes for businesses and governmental agencies as director for the Institute for Training and Development at Seattle Community College.
-- JILL MARSDEN Marsden was promoted from executive vice president to president of Network Management Inc. and Network Health Plan Inc., health-care providers.
OTHER ANNOUNCEMENTS:
-- COMMUNICATIONS
Aileen Griffey will be responsible for sales and service of small and medium business telephone systems in Washington and Oregon as general manager for AT&T's General Business Systems division.
-- CONSULTING
Diane Anderson was named vice president of administration for Management Advisory Services Inc., a training, consulting and valuation company.
-- EDUCATION
The Seattle Pacific University board of trustees elected the following as members: David Beagle of Gray Line of Seattle; Stephen Delamarter of Everett Free Methodist Church; Charles Dohner of the Department of Medical Education at the University of Washington; Judith Fortune of Seattle Pacific University; and Nathan Thuline of Medical Diagnostic Specialties Inc.
-- ENVIRONMENT
Gerald Portele was promoted from associate director of the Hazardous Materials Management group to director for Tetra Tech Inc., an environmental-science and engineering company. John Crawford was named contingency planning and training coordinator for Foss Environmental, a division of Foss Maritime.
-- MEDIA
Sherry Sharer was named vice president and assistant secretary and Sharon Greenfield was appointed vice president and director of human resources for Fisher Broadcasting Inc. of Seattle. Scott Hayner, general sales manager, was named vice president for KOMO TV, owned and operated by Fisher Broadcasting Inc.
-- ORGANIZATIONS
O. Yale Lewis Jr., partner at Hendricks & Lewis, was elected president of the Seattle Public Library Board of Trustees. The Washington State Chapter of the International Society for Retirement Planning elected Diana Parkison, of Washington State Retirement Systems, president; Paul Bishop, of Short, Cressman & Burgess, vice president; Andy Landis, of Thinking Retirement, treasurer; and Helyn Brent, of Airborne Express, secretary.
